The GB 21221-2007 standard sets forth the essential technical parameters that capacitor insulating oils must meet to ensure reliability and longevity in electrical applications. These parameters include appearance, density, acid number, flash point, pour point, viscosity, breakdown voltage, dielectric loss factor, volume resistivity, and water content.
